Good use of dialogue throughout the story, and I could feel the medieval atmosphere as the story developed.

I think just the right amount of sensory input and description washed over this story. Not too much but just enough.

I couldn’t pick up anything to really nit-pick about except to remember to edit it over and over again. I found some mistakes.

King Katush might have benefited from further character development, but that is probably just a moot point, along with the others. Some readers like strong character development, and others not so much. But I can add that the characters in this story definitely were not flat!!

Overall, the story seemed to balanced well, but at times I had some difficulty in following along, but not much. Mr. Barlow is from Scotland and I am from the hills of Pennsylvania. I’m sure with some of my writings he would say the same!! Little differences in dialogue and explanation between two English speaking people from different areas of the world are to be expected! And I wish to point out I had only a little here and there.


It was a nice story, well written and one that could hold my interest!

For his first story, this one is a success!!!
